      <description>&lt;P&gt;Yes, please.&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Our company deals with this on every project. We use 14" I-joist rafters for insulation value, and step them down to 5 1/2" outside the building envelope; at the eave and rake overhangs (nobody wants a 14" fascia on a house). This requires modeling two separate roof elements every time (not very efficient).&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Thank you&amp;nbsp;&lt;a href="https://forums.autodesk.com/t5/user/viewprofilepage/user-id/4679003"&gt;@artay4LN6E&lt;/a&gt;&amp;nbsp; for posting this important topic.&lt;/P&gt;</description>

      <description>&lt;P&gt;Simply you need to select your roof and go to the properties panel. For the Rafter Cut under construction select (Two Cut - Plumb) and set the Fascia Depth at 5 1/2" or whatever you want.&lt;/P&gt;</description>

      <description>&lt;P&gt;Thanks for the suggestion&amp;nbsp;&lt;a href="https://forums.autodesk.com/t5/user/viewprofilepage/user-id/11744743"&gt;@KhaledAlSayyed&lt;/a&gt;&amp;nbsp;, however changing the fascia cut will only cut the vertical face of the roof element to a specific dimension. It will not allow the entire overhang (the portion beyond the exterior wall sheathing) to step down to a smaller dimension.       <description>&lt;P&gt;Here's my workaround:&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Architecture: Build --&amp;gt; Component --&amp;gt; Model in Place --&amp;gt; Roofs&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Name block according to elevation (such as "South Dormer Cut") if doing multiple&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Set Reference Plane to Fascia&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Select Void Form Extrusion&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Create extrusion of what you would like to delete -- align inner edge to wall face&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Cut&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Finish Model&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Paint revealed surface to match adjacent wall&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Hide linework in view&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Use hide lines&lt;/P&gt;</description>
